Description
System C is the UK\’s leading health and social care software and services company. Our easy-to-use IT platforms provide a complete view of the individual across all care settings, helping integrate services and improve care. We are a British company with over 35 years\’ experience.
Our finance team is seeking a Billing Coordinator to ensure accurate and efficient billing to meet the business operational requirements and provide high standards of customer service. The ideal candidate will have a strong ability to solve problems and understand complex billing schedules, along with a proven history of delivering excellent service. They should pay close attention to detail and communicate effectively.
Upon hire, the successful candidate will assist in the development and improvement of billing procedures and systems to encourage prompt billing and debt collection based on customer contracts.
The Billing Administrator is responsible for the following:
- Arrange for collection of customer purchase orders to support timely billing
- Efficient and accurate billing of customer contracts as per billing schedules for recurring and non-recurring revenue, including application of annual indexation
- Provide support to customers with disputes or inquiries concerning invoices or billing process and resolve queries in a timely and professional manner
- Supporting the Credit Controllers as required with billing enquiries which are holding up cash collection processes
- Support external audits by gathering documentation and ensuring compliance
